Verenn:

Verenn is a modern rock band from Finland. Verenn's music is characterised by strong guitar riffs with metal nuances and catchy vocal melodies with lots of emotion. Influences range from industrial to heavy, from grunge to pop - but what it all boils down to is great rock tunes with interesting and intelligent lyrics. To hell with genre definitions!


The brain of Verenn is Jussi Järvenpää, the founding father of the band. Jussi is not only an incredibly talented composer but also an insightful producer and sound engineer.

The original and characteristic Verenn sound is Jussi's creation from the scratch.


Respectively, then, Mikko Hautakangas could be called Verenn's heart, as he brings the songs to life with his vocals. Mikko's lyrics are one of Verenn's essential strengths, as they take the attitudes and athmospheres of the music and give them meanings that relate to the social reality of the listeners, without simply recycling rock 'n roll clichés.

Biography:

Although the first chords for Verenn were struck as early as in the spring 2000 in Jussi's home studio, the true beginning can be placed in the summer 2003. By then Jussi had went through some failed attempts with different vocalists, and finally turned to Mikko, with whom he had previously played in the same band for years.

The co-operation kicked off wonderfully. The chemistry between old close friends seemed to work even musically, and Mikko's vocal parts brought new dimensions to the Verenn sound, moving it from the more traditional heavy metal towards modern rock.

Soon the first demo with two songs (Soul and Stars Are Out Of Place) was recorded (in 2004). Although the working method of Verenn was only taking its baby steps at that time, the demo received a great deal of positive attention in the music forums of the internet.

In April 2005, Verenn joined forces with another band called Maplesnow and started their own record label, Matara Music. The label's first release was Verenn's Awake EP, released in June 2005.

Awake gained some encouraging feedback and radio airplay around Europe. The EP contained three tracks: Awake, Pilot and Nobody Wins. The title track also gained attention as it was featured on a Finnish new school video Destination Changed, which won The Most Innovative Approach -category in the world's biggest ski video contest Vast Awards.

In 2005 Jussi's brother Jaakko Järvenpää, who had been involved in the creative processes of Verenn from the earliest stages and played guitar on the recordings, decided to withdraw from the band.

It was time for the first true display of power of Verenn. The song material for the debut album was written in the latter half of 2005, and the recordings took place mainly in November '05 - January '06. The first single No Trace, No Sound was released in 31st of March, 2006, and the album, titled The Game, saw daylight on 19th of May.

The rest will make history. The ten songs featured on The Game paint a panorama picture of what Verenn is about - where the band comes from and what they are moving towards. The range from metal- influenced rock via pop towards epic and athmospheric emo-rock displays the band's versatility and courage, and simultaneously awakes anticipation for the future - if this is the start, then what might this band eventually have to offer?
